The Chestnut Hill College Women's Bowling team completed their first day at the Golden Bear Invite hosted by Kutztown University on Saturday winning two matches while sitting in eighth place after the day's five traditional matches.
The Griffins defeated Bloomfield College 725-660 in their second match of the day and closed out the afternoon with an 865-634 win over Coppin State university. With the two wins the team sits at 7-11 overall.
Kayleina McGonigal led the Griffins in the win over Bloomfield, rolling a 194.Â
Gabriella Munsey was the next high scorer on the Chestnut Hill squad with a score of 146.
McGonigal again led the team in the win over Coppin State with a score of 195 while
Abbey Crumb turned in her high match of the day with a score of 184.
The Griffins opened the tournament dropping a close match to Felician University 875-864. McGonigal had her high match of the day with a score of 203 followed by
Jess Hollabaugh with a score of 194.Â
Chase Clifford also had her high match of the day with a score of 164 while Munsey rolled a 153.Â
Eryn Moore rounded out the CHC bowlers in the opening match with a score of 140.
Another close loss followed in the Griffins' third match as the fell to Fairleigh Dickinson university 842-833. Hollabaugh and McGonigal led the team with scores of 182 and 174 respectively.
Host Kutztown University handed the Griffins another close loss, 865-823 following the FDU match. Hollabaugh and Moore both bowled their high matches of the day with scores of 188 and 170 respectively. Clifford added a score of 163.
Tournament action continues on Sunday with four baker format matches followed by a best-of-seven baker match to determine final placing.
